SAFETY PRECAUTIONS

PLEASE READ BEFORE USING THIS UNIT

1. Battery acid is highly corrosive. If spillage occurs, wipe off immediately and 

wash copiously with water. Particularly avoid contact with the eyes, but if 
this occurs, you must seek medical advice.

2. When charging is completed, ensure that the vehicle battery leads are 

secured to the proper terminals which should be clean, and lightly 
smeared with petroleum jelly to prevent corrosion. Finally, re-check the 
electrolyte level.

3. Do not expose this charger to rain.

4. Never touch together the negative and positive leads on this unit whilst the 

unit is switched on.

5. Never attempt any electrical or mechanical repair. If you have a problem 

with your machine contact your local stockist for service information.

6. Before charging ensure the battery terminals are clean and that the cells 

are filled with electrolyte to the correct level by adding distilled water 
where necessary.

7. This appliance is not intended for use by persons (including children) with 

reduced physical, sensory or mental capabilities, or lack of experience and 
knowledge, unless they have been given supervision or instruction 
concerning use of the charger by a person responsible for their safety. 
Children should be supervised to ensure that they do not play with the 
charger. 

WARNING: BECAUSE HIGHLY INFLAMMABLE HYDROGEN GAS IS 
RELEASED IN THE PROCESS OF BATTERY CHARGING, PLEASE REMEMBER 
TO SWITCH OFF THE CHARGER FIRST, AND SO AVOID SPARKING WHICH 
WILL OCCUR WHEN CONNECTING OR DISCONNECTING LIVE LEADS.

WARNING: CERTAIN TYPES OF SEALED OR MAINTENANCE-FREE BATTERIES 
NEED EXTRA CARE WHEN CHARGING. PLEASE CONSULT BATTERY 
MANUFACTURERS INSTRUCTIONS BEFORE USING THIS UNIT.

WARNING: SINCE TOXIC FUMES MAY BE RELEASED DURING BATTERY 
CHARGING, ONLY USE THIS UNIT IN A WELL VENTILATED AREA.
